It is shown that the separation constant not related to isometries that appears in the solution of the spin-0264-9381/13/11/024/img2 perturbations of the Carter A solution, can be defined in an invariant way as the eigenvalue of a certain differential operator made out of a two-index Killing spinor. Furthermore, when the electromagnetic field of the background spacetime is absent, we obtain analogous results for gravitational perturbations.
